Men's Basketball Falls In River City Rumble

Nze, Lanier Combined For 30 Points Versus Jacksonville

JACKSONVILLE, Fla. - North Florida men's basketball (15-14, 8-6) were unable to hold on to its halftime lead on the other side of town, as they dropped its road finale against Jacksonville (14-14, 5-9), 62-50, in the River City Rumble on Friday evening.

The Ospreys were held to 50 total points against the Dolphins after scoring 25 points in each half. Jah Nze led UNF with 17 points, while Chaz Lanier added another 13 points in 38 minutes played.

BEYOND THE BOX SCORE

First Half
Jasai Miles shot a long three to start and drained it from distance to get the first points of the game for the Ospreys...back-to-back treys were made by Dorian James and Lanier to expand the lead to six points early...Nze threw a lob to Lanier from just inside half court, followed by a three from Nze, to go up by nine points...the sophomore made another three to keep the lead at double digits...Miles kept the Dolphins at ease with another three to stay up top...free throws from Nze ended the first half with UNF holding a two-point lead.

Second Half
After technical free throws were made by Lanier, Miles scored again to open up the half with a driving layup...Nze matched the score to give UNF the lead back after being tied at 29 a piece...Jaylen Smith stopped a scoring run from the Dolphins, followed by Lanier free throws, with just under 10 minutes left...UNF went on a 7-0 run highlighted by another Nze three to pull it back within single digits...Lanier and Lliteras both scored in the final five minutes, but it wasn't enough to pull off the second-half comeback on the road.

NOTES

  • After minimal time played before last weekend, Nze has now scored over 16 points in two of his last three games.
  • This was the first time all season that Chaz Lanier has been held to less than 14 points in conference play.
  • It's also the first time since Feb. 23, 2022, that UNF has scored 50 points or less in an ASUN game.
  • Only the fourth loss to Jacksonville in the last 12 matchups between the two teams.
